New Jersey Statutes

§ 56:10-26 — Definitions.

New Jersey·Title 56 TRADE NAMES, TRADE-MARKS AND UNFAIR TRADE PRACTICES

1. As used in this act: "Consumer" means the purchaser, other than for resale, of a motor vehicle. "Franchise" means a written arrangement for a definite or indefinite period in which a motor vehicle franchisor grants a right or license to use a trade name, trademark, service mark or related characteristics and in which there is a community of interest in the marketing of new motor vehicles at retail, by lease, agreement or otherwise. "Motor vehicle" means and includes all vehicles propelled otherwise than by muscular power, and motorcycles, trailers and tractors, excepting:
